The Kenwood KMD-673R Car MiniDisc Player features a built-in 45 watts power amplifier. Kenwood is a leading developer and manufacturer of consumer electronics products for home and car use. Kenwood products are distributed in over 120 countries around the world.

Product Identifiers
BrandKenwood
ModelKMD-673R
MPNkmd673r

Key Features
Player TypeMiniDisc
Tuner TypeFM / AM
Built-In Amplifier Power4-Channel x 45 Watt
Number of Channels4-Channel

Additional Features
Controller TypeCD Changer, Mini Disk Player

Radio
FM Presets18
AM Presets12

longplay MD player good allround

Created: 10/01/09
Briefly, this is the second unit I have bought (for the mrs car) to replace the tape player. MD is just very handy, and this player can play the LP2 and LP4 discs (NOT the hiMD).

It has a 4 channel amp, but I have it connected to a power amp, however it only has a single RCA / phono output (and is linked to the REAR fader?) so I use a 2 to 4, to feed the bass and front. also controls a CD changer and displays text if available on the disc (CDTEXT) and RDS text from radio. Using a changer / splitter (eg S210A) you can have an AUX mp3 input as well as CD (appears as AUX in the sources).

Anyway, brief review of the item for the factors that were important to me when buying it. Manual is available at Kenwood support. It does need a dedicated Kenwood connector (not ISO as some other models) but can be obtained from eBay for sub 5 pounds.

Kenwood KMD-673R Car MiniDisc Player

Created: 30/01/10
For those looking for a car MD player capable of playing LP formats, look no further. The sound quality of this unit is excellent and its ability to switch seamlessly from different modes SP/2*LP/4*LP is great. Four or five albums on a little disc rather than a single album on a CD is great for reducing clutter in the cabin. It was also a doddle to add an Aux input lead to allow my MP3 player to plug into the system when I want to. The button backlight colour can be switched between red and green, which allows it to blend in with many internal car lighting systems. If I have one tiny gripe,it is that the blue button, which switches the unit on and off and cycles between sources, is a little too bright for my liking. As gripes go, that's really trivial. If you still need to use MD, get this.

Kenwood KMD-673R MiniDisc Player

Created: 04/01/09
Good quality player, a bit idiosyncratic in its use, no pause key or mute key neither a remote - unless wired in with built in telephonic interface. other than that , easy to use, changeable colour lights and very good sound. Easy to install,easily supports ipod and cartridge stack unit with optional upgrades.

Overall a very good player not excellent coz its missing a few touches, but worthy none the less
